Reform UK MP Lee Anderson has furiously hit out at a Labour MP’s criticism of Nigel Farage.
Speaking on GB News, Mike Tapp, the Labour MP for Dover and Deal, branded the Reform Party leader an “opportunist” who is guilty of “fawning over” Vladimir Putin.
He said Nigel is “not a patriot” and has a history of not working in Britain’s best interests.
Lee joined Martin Daubney on the People’s Channel to respond, and he did not hold back in a scathing assessment of the Labour MP.

He said: “I’ve come across this politician before in a Westminster Hall debate when I challenged him on the illegal migration problem we’ve got.
“30,000 illegal migrants have come across the Channel since Labour come to power and gone right to his backyard.

“The ramblings we heard were the ramblings of a desperate, unhinged individual. He hasn’t got a clue.
“What I want to do is get him on this show and I will go head to head with this clown of an MP.
“He’s up and down in the House of Commons on a regular basis spouting absolute nonsense. If you’re watching Mike Tapp, I would suggest putting an ‘ed’ at the end of your surname, because he’s utterly tapped.”
GB News’s Political Editor Christopher Hope jumped to Tapp’s defence, bluntly telling Lee: “No he’s not [tapped].”
He added: “He’s a former soldier. This guy has served three deployments, he’s a veteran.
“He deserves a bit more respect.”
It comes amid a raging debate about Britain’s role in the Ukraine conflict and whether Prime Minister Keir Starmer should be focusing more on matters closer to home.
Martin and Tapp clashed on the matter on GB News, with the former claiming the PM is having a torrid time defending Britain’s borders, meaning he should not be concerning himself with the struggles of others.
Tapp said Martin was making a “false equivalence” as Russia’s invasion of Ukraine could end up having a direct impact on Britain.
He argued ordinary Britons will inevitably feel an economic pinch from Russia’s invasion of Ukraine, as they already have.
“We’ve seen the insecurities this war that this war has dealt on this country”, he said.
Martin said Britain, along with other leading European nations, has done “literally nothing” to try and stop the war.
The Labour MP said Ukraine has been able to continue fending Russia off bravely thanks to Britain being stalwart in its support of its efforts.
“It’s important we remain behind Ukraine but of course, we have to move towards peace”, he said.
GB News has approached Mike Tapp for comment.
